The fundamental gap for a one-dimensional Schr\"odinger operator with Robin boundary conditions

Abstract

For Schr\"odinger operators on an interval with either convex or symmetric single-well potentials, and Robin or Neumann boundary conditions, the gap between the two lowest eigenvalues is minimised when the potential is constant. We also have results for the pp-Laplacian.
